What to Look for in an Event Florist
Choosing the right event florist can be a daunting task, especially when there are so many options available in Orange County. Here are several key factors to consider:
- Portfolio of Work: Review the florist’s previous work to gauge their style and expertise. Look for versatility in designs and the ability to handle different types of events.
- References and Reviews: Seek referrals from friends or check online reviews. Platforms like WeddingWire and The Knot can provide insights into customer satisfaction.
- Pricing Structure: Inquire about the florist’s pricing structure. Some florists have set packages while others may provide a quote based on your specific needs. Understanding their pricing will aid in aligning your budget with your floral needs.
- Communication Skills: A good florist should be able to listen effectively and understand your vision while also providing insights to enhance your ideas.
- Availability: Ensure that the florist can accommodate your event date and has sufficient resources to handle your order, especially during peak seasons.

Seasonal Flower Choices in Orange County
In Orange County, the climate allows for a wide variety of flowers to bloom throughout the year. Seasonal selections can significantly influence the aesthetics and costs of your floral arrangements:
- Spring: Tulips, peonies, and ranunculus are in season, perfect for weddings and garden parties.
- Summer: Sunflowers, dahlias, and roses are popular for their vibrant colors and robust nature, suitable for outdoor events.
- Fall: Autumn-themed arrangements often feature chrysanthemums, dahlias, and orange-hued blooms for seasonal elegance.
- Winter: Poinsettias and evergreens can be utilized for holiday parties and winter weddings to create a cozy atmosphere.

Budgeting for Floral Designs in Event Planning
Floral arrangements can vary widely in cost depending on the event’s size, the flowers chosen, and the complexity of the designs. Setting a clear budget is essential for ensuring your floral dreams become a reality without financial stress.
Estimating Costs for Different Event Types
Costs can significantly differ based on the type of event and the level of complexity involved:
- Weddings: Typically, floral costs can range from 10% to 20% of the overall wedding budget. For an average wedding in Orange County, expect to pay between $2,000 and $5,000 depending on guest count and floral choices.
- Corporate Events: Depending on the scale, corporate floral arrangements can range from $500 to $3,000, particularly for events seeking a polished, professional look.
- Private Celebrations: For events like milestone birthdays, costs may start from $200 for modest arrangements but can increase with extravagance.
How to Communicate Your Budget to Your Florist
Clearly communicating your budget to your florist is vital to ensure your floral needs align with what you can afford. Consider these tips:
- Be Honest: Lay out your budget upfront to allow your florist to tailor their designs accordingly.
- Discuss Priorities: Identify which areas of floral design are most important to you (e.g., bouquets versus centerpieces) and allocate your budget accordingly.
- Ask About Alternatives: If the chosen flowers are out of your price range, a good florist will propose alternatives that keep your designs within budget.
Maximizing Value with Affordable Orange County Event Florists
Even on a tight budget, you can still have stunning floral arrangements. Consider these strategies:
- DIY Options: For smaller events, consider creating some arrangements yourself, sourcing flowers from local markets or wholesalers.
- Minimalism: Focusing on fewer, larger arrangements can provide a luxe look without overwhelming your budget.
- Seasonal Selections: Using in-season flowers typically costs less, so take advantage of local bounty to cut costs.

Initial Consultations: What to Prepare
Before your first meeting with a florist, it’s helpful to come prepared:
- Visual Inspirations: Bring images or samples that reflect your desired style to help your florist understand your aesthetic.
- Guest Count: Provide an approximate headcount to assist your florist in planning the quantity and types of arrangements needed.
- Venue Details: Share information about the event space, including photos if possible, to inform how flowers can best be arranged.

Finalizing Your Selection and Contract Details
Once you’ve narrowed your search, it’s essential to finalize your decision based on a few key steps:
- Contract Review: Carefully review all contract details to ensure that everything discussed verbally is documented.
- Deposit Requirements: Understand the deposit amounts required to secure your florist’s services and their cancellation policy.
- Final Confirmation: As your event date approaches, confirm details such as arrangements, delivery times, and setups to ensure a seamless experience.
